I like all of the above plus diced tomatoes, cukes, bell peppers of
any color, sweet onions, sliced radishes, coarsely grated carrots.
"My" dressing needs mayo and miracle whip, celery seed, a little sugar
or sweet pickle juice and a healthy shot of Tabasco. I use shells for
macaroni. I would KILL to be able to eat this right now!
